Which adhesive composition delivers optimal tack strength for synthetic carpet backings?

Acrylic nano-gel formulations represent the most widely adopted solution in commercial carpet tape manufacturing, utilizing cross-linked pressure-sensitive adhesive (PSA) technology suspended in a clear acrylic polymer matrix. This material excels in B2B procurement scenarios due to its immediate bonding capability and optical clarity, essential for exhibition halls and retail environments where visible tape lines compromise aesthetics. The formulation demonstrates strong shear resistance on low-surface-energy substrates common in polypropylene and nylon carpet backings. However, procurement managers must account for thermal limitations; acrylic adhesives experience significant viscosity reduction and creep failure when substrate temperatures exceed 60°C (140°F), rendering them unsuitable for outdoor installations in arid climates or unventilated warehouse spaces during summer months. The material offers excellent value for high-volume orders, making it ideal for standardized commercial projects with controlled climate conditions.

What washable gel systems maximize asset reusability in temporary commercial installations?

Polyurethane (PU) gel tapes provide superior elasticity and washability compared to acrylic alternatives, enabling multiple repositioning cycles without adhesive delamination or residue transfer. This characteristic proves particularly valuable for event management companies, pop-up retail operators, and property management firms across Europe and South America requiring frequent spatial reconfigurations. PU formulations maintain consistent adhesion across broader temperature ranges, typically performing reliably from -20°C to 80°C, which accommodates warehouses with minimal climate control or seasonal temperature fluctuations. The material’s closed-cell structure resists moisture absorption, preventing mold growth in humid environments common in Vietnamese and Brazilian markets. Nevertheless, B2B buyers face higher per-meter costs and extended curing periods—often 24-48 hours for full bond strength—which can impact project timelines. Strategic inventory forecasting becomes essential when specifying PU systems for large-scale deployments.

How do nano-silica composites perform under extreme thermal stress in industrial applications?

Advanced nano-silica enhanced adhesives incorporate precisely engineered silicon dioxide nanoparticles (typically 20-100nm) into acrylic or hybrid polymer bases, creating three-dimensional bonding networks that resist thermal creep and shear forces. This technology addresses critical adhesive failure modes prevalent in Middle Eastern and North African markets, where surface temperatures frequently exceed 70°C and standard acrylics liquefy under load. The composite structure enhances humidity resistance for tropical climates while maintaining aggressive tack on textured carpet backings where smooth gels fail to conform. For procurement teams, the 30-40% price premium over standard acrylics is offset by reduced material consumption—narrower tape widths achieve equivalent holding power—and elimination of costly callback visits for re-adhesion. However, these formulations require precise application pressure and surface preparation, demanding contractor training investments that may challenge markets with less specialized installation labor pools.

In-depth Look: Manufacturing Processes and Quality Assurance for Nano carpet tape

Understanding the manufacturing backbone of nano carpet tape is critical for procurement teams sourcing from international suppliers. Unlike standard adhesive tapes, nano carpet tape relies on micro-suction gel technology rather than traditional pressure-sensitive adhesives, requiring specialized production environments and rigorous quality protocols to ensure batch consistency across global supply chains.

How Is Nano Carpet Tape Manufactured for High-Volume B2B Supply?

The production of industrial-grade nano carpet tape begins with precision polymer synthesis, where medical-grade acrylic resins are formulated into nano-gel compounds containing microscopic suction cavities. Manufacturers utilize precision coating heads to apply these gel layers onto specialized backing films—typically PET (polyethylene terephthalate) or PE (polyethylene)—at thicknesses ranging from 0.5mm to 2.0mm depending on load-bearing requirements. The critical manufacturing phase involves creating the micro-structured surface geometry that generates vacuum adhesion through millions of tiny suction cups per square centimeter. This requires cleanroom environments with controlled humidity below 60% to prevent contamination during the curing process. Following gel application, automated slitting lines convert master rolls into specified widths (commonly 20mm, 30mm, or 50mm) with tolerances of ±0.5mm, ensuring compatibility with automated carpet installation equipment used by commercial flooring contractors.

What Raw Material Specifications Determine Performance Grades?

B2B buyers must distinguish between premium and economy grades based on acrylic polymer purity and backing film specifications. High-performance nano carpet tape utilizes solvent-free acrylic formulations with 99%+ purity levels, offering superior aging resistance compared to industrial-grade alternatives containing plasticizers that degrade under UV exposure. The backing film selection significantly impacts application suitability—PET films provide dimensional stability for heavy-duty commercial carpets in high-traffic areas, while PE films offer flexibility for irregular surfaces common in temporary event installations. Release liners require silicone coating uniformity to prevent adhesive transfer during unwinding, particularly important in humid climates where liner separation failures can cause production waste. Procurement teams should verify that suppliers utilize virgin resin materials rather than recycled polymers, as post-consumer content can compromise the nano-gel’s elastic recovery properties essential for washability and reuse.

How Do Manufacturers Validate Washability and Reusability Claims?

Quality assurance protocols for washable nano carpet tape involve cyclic testing that simulates real-world cleaning scenarios. Reputable manufacturers subject samples to ASTM D3330 peel adhesion testing before and after multiple wash cycles, typically requiring 90%+ adhesion retention after 50+ water immersions and air-drying cycles. The testing evaluates not only adhesion strength but also gel surface integrity, ensuring that microscopic suction structures remain intact after lint and dust particle removal. Additionally, manufacturers conduct shear strength testing at elevated temperatures (40°C-60°C) to simulate drying conditions in tropical markets like Vietnam or Brazil, verifying that the gel compound does not flow or lose structural integrity when exposed to heat during air-drying or machine drying processes. These validation procedures ensure that carpet tape marketed as “reusable” maintains performance specifications across multiple installation cycles, reducing total cost of ownership for facility management companies.

Essential Technical Properties and Trade Terminology for Nano carpet tape

When sourcing nano carpet tape for commercial flooring projects, understanding the technical specifications and industry nomenclature ensures you select products that meet performance benchmarks while complying with regional installation standards. Unlike conventional double-sided carpet tapes that rely on chemical adhesion, nano-adhesive systems utilize gel-based micro-suction technology, requiring distinct evaluation criteria for B2B procurement.

What Are the Critical Technical Specifications for Heavy-Duty Nano Carpet Tape?

1. Gel Layer Caliper (Thickness)
The gel layer thickness, typically ranging from 0.5mm to 2.0mm, determines gap-filling capability for uneven carpet backings and overall shear resistance. Thicker calipers (1.5mm–2.0mm) accommodate textured hand-tufted wool or Berber carpets common in Middle Eastern and European hospitality sectors, while thinner profiles optimize for smooth-backed commercial broadloom. Density specifications, measured in kg/m³, indicate micro-suction cup concentration, with industrial grades requiring ≥800 kg/m³ for high-traffic applications.

2. Shear Resistance and Load Bearing Capacity
Shear resistance indicates the tape’s ability to withstand lateral movement under static load, typically quantified in kilograms per square centimeter (kg/cm²) or pounds per square inch (psi). Premium nano carpet tapes offer load-bearing capacities of 0.5–1.0 psi, sufficient for heavy furniture and commercial foot traffic without creep or edge lifting.

3. Operating Temperature Range
For international buyers managing diverse climates, verify temperature stability between -20°C (-4°F) and 65°C (150°F). This range ensures adhesive integrity in unheated South American logistics facilities during winter and UV-exposed Middle Eastern warehouse environments. The glass transition temperature (Tg) should remain below -10°C to prevent gel brittleness in cold storage applications.

4. Washability Cycle Rating
This specification quantifies how many times the tape can be rinsed with water and reapplied while maintaining ≥80% of initial adhesion. Commercial-grade nano tapes typically guarantee 50–100 wash cycles, significantly impacting total cost of ownership for temporary exhibition flooring or seasonal retail installations in African and European markets.

5. Optical Clarity and UV Stability
Measured as light transmission percentage or haze index, optical clarity determines aesthetic suitability for transparent applications where carpet edges remain visible. UV resistance ratings (measured per ASTM D4329) prevent yellowing and adhesion degradation in sun-exposed atriums or storefront installations.

6. Surface Energy Compatibility Range
Expressed in dynes per centimeter (dynes/cm), this indicates which carpet backing materials the gel will effectively bond with. Polypropylene (PP) backings (29–31 dynes/cm) require nano tapes formulated with polar functional groups, whereas high-surface-energy substrates like glass or sealed concrete (40–50 dynes/cm) bond readily with standard formulations.

What Industry Terminology Should B2B Buyers Master When Sourcing Nano Adhesive Systems?

1. Nano-Grab® / Micro-Suction Technology
Proprietary terms describing gel adhesives containing thousands of microscopic suction cups per square centimeter that create vacuum bonds rather than chemical bonds. This technology enables residue-free removal critical for leased commercial spaces or heritage building renovations where substrate preservation is mandatory.

2. Gel Adhesive vs. Pressure-Sensitive Adhesive (PSA)
While traditional carpet tapes use foam carriers coated with acrylic PSAs, nano tapes utilize viscoelastic gel polymers (typically polyurethane or advanced acrylic gels) that flow into surface irregularities at the microscopic level. This distinction affects conformability and removability characteristics.

3. Removability Index
A classification system indicating the tape’s removal difficulty and residue potential. “Clean removability” signifies zero adhesive transfer for up to six months on painted drywall or finished concrete, essential for temporary event carpeting in German exhibition halls or Vietnamese convention centers.

4. Initial Tack vs. Ultimate Adhesion
Initial tack describes immediate grip upon application (preventing carpet curling during installation), while ultimate adhesion refers to maximum holding strength achieved after 24–72 hours of dwell time. B2B specifications should distinguish between these values to ensure immediate stability during high-traffic openings.

5. Die-Cutting Tolerance
Specifies precision in converting master rolls to custom widths, typically expressed as ±0.5mm or ±1.0mm variance. Tight tolerances ensure clean edges along carpet tile seams (e.g., 50cm or 60cm modules) without adhesive overhang that attracts particulate contamination in cleanroom or healthcare environments.

6. Substrate Surface Energy
A material science term describing the wettability of carpet backing materials. Low-surface-energy substrates like polypropylene or polyethylene require corona-treated nano tapes or gel formulations with enhanced polar components to achieve proper molecular attraction and prevent delamination.

Frequently Asked Questions (FAQs) for B2B Buyers of Nano carpet tape

What is nano carpet tape used for in commercial flooring installations?

Nano carpet tape serves as a removable mounting solution for temporary and semi-permanent flooring applications across exhibition centers, hospitality venues, and corporate office spaces. Unlike permanent adhesives, this transparent gel-based tape secures carpet tiles, runners, and area rugs to subfloors without damaging underlying surfaces such as polished concrete, marble, or hardwood. Commercial users frequently deploy it for trade show booth installations, hotel event conversions, and construction site temporary flooring where rapid deployment and clean removal are critical operational requirements.

How does nano carpet tape compare to traditional double-sided carpet adhesives?

Traditional carpet tapes utilize foam carriers with aggressive rubber or acrylic adhesives that create permanent bonds and often leave residue upon removal, whereas nano carpet tape employs a washable gel polymer technology that maintains adhesion through microscopic suction rather than chemical bonding. This fundamental difference allows nano tape to support loads up to 1 pound per 4 inches of tape while remaining completely removable and reusable across multiple installations. For B2B buyers, this translates to reduced material waste, lower labor costs during de-installation, and the ability to reposition flooring elements without surface damage or adhesive cleanup expenses.

Is nano carpet tape suitable for high-traffic office and hospitality environments?

Nano carpet tape demonstrates exceptional performance in high-traffic commercial settings when properly applied, maintaining adhesion across temperature ranges from -20°F to 200°F (-29°C to 93°C) and resisting UV degradation in sunlit atriums or lobby areas. The gel composition creates a strong anti-slip grip that prevents carpet migration in busy corridors and reception areas while accommodating the flex and movement inherent in commercial carpet tiles. Facilities managers in hotels, convention centers, and multinational offices benefit from its immediate tack strength that requires no curing time, allowing spaces to remain operational during installation and modification.

What are the bulk specifications and wholesale pricing structures for international procurement?

Standard commercial nano carpet tape specifications include widths ranging from 0.94 inches (24mm) to 2 inches (50mm), with roll lengths available in 5-foot consumer segments up to 100-foot contractor rolls for large-scale deployment. Bulk procurement typically involves MOQs of 500-1000 rolls per container load, with thickness options varying from 1mm to 3mm depending on load-bearing requirements. Wholesale pricing follows tiered volume breaks at 1000, 5000, and 10,000+ roll quantities, with FOB pricing structures accommodating port destinations across Africa (Lagos, Mombasa), South America (Santos, Cartagena), the Middle East (Jeddah, Dubai), and European hubs (Hamburg, Rotterdam).

How does nano carpet tape perform in high-humidity and tropical climates common in Africa and Southeast Asia?

The acrylic gel formulation of nano carpet tape exhibits superior moisture resistance compared to traditional rubber-based adhesives, maintaining adhesion integrity in relative humidity levels up to 90% common in tropical African, Middle Eastern, and Southeast Asian environments. Unlike standard carpet tapes that delaminate or lose tack in humid conditions, nano gel technology creates a stable bond that resists moisture penetration while allowing vapor transmission to prevent mold accumulation beneath flooring. Procurement teams sourcing for projects in Vietnam, Nigeria, or Brazil should specify UV-stabilized formulations to prevent degradation in intense equatorial sunlight and ensure temperature ratings accommodate ambient conditions exceeding 40°C (104°F).

Can nano carpet tape be washed and reused for multiple commercial installation cycles?

One of the primary value propositions for B2B buyers is the reusability factor; nano carpet tape can be washed with warm water to remove dust, fibers, and debris, restoring approximately 85-90% of original adhesion strength for subsequent installations. This characteristic proves particularly cost-effective for event rental companies, exhibition contractors, and facilities management firms that cycle flooring configurations quarterly or monthly. To maximize reuse cycles, store cleaned tape in original release liners or silicone-coated paper, avoiding dust contamination that compromises the microscopic suction properties essential for adhesion.

What surface preparation protocols ensure optimal adhesion on concrete, tile, and hardwood substrates?

Successful commercial application requires thorough surface preparation regardless of substrate type, beginning with complete removal of dust, oils, and previous adhesive residues using isopropyl alcohol or neutral pH cleaners. Porous surfaces such as unfinished concrete or brick require additional attention to ensure the gel makes full contact rather than bonding to surface dust particles. For polished stone and hardwood common in European and Middle Eastern commercial spaces, verify that floor sealants are fully cured (minimum 30 days) and avoid application over waxed surfaces that may transfer onto the tape backing, compromising reusability.

How do I calculate material quantities and placement patterns for large-scale commercial deployments?

Material calculation for commercial projects depends on carpet weight and traffic patterns, with standard practice recommending continuous perimeter application plus cross-pattern strips every 24-36 inches for carpet tiles, or full-grid application for heavy-duty exhibition carpeting. For B2B quantity estimation, one 100-foot roll of 2-inch tape typically covers 50-75 square meters of carpet tile installation depending on grid spacing. When sourcing for hotel corridors or office complexes, consider ordering 15-20% additional stock to accommodate pattern matching, cutting waste, and on-site adjustments, particularly for irregularly shaped installation areas common in historic European buildings or modern architectural spaces.
